Transaction 57e1e3c86fcb80b1e97582d2b720777c31d0ea3a866e387fa3290d0484a79449

1 Input
2 Outputs
  • 57e1e3c86fcb80b1e97582d2b720777c31d0ea3a866e387fa3290d0484a79449:0
  • value  309652432
    address  3AWWFDUgMcxVdZNBNRZqkBpzRkB5z4nZ2T
  • 57e1e3c86fcb80b1e97582d2b720777c31d0ea3a866e387fa3290d0484a79449:1
  • value  821658
    address  32dyhBvFGuBLpnDYTiQwAEaXczP1kpxTUi